Fayette’s Johnson chooses Clemson
For the AJC
Friday, June 19, 2009
Basketball standout Noel Johnson of Fayette County High, who withdrew from a commitment with Southern Cal, accepted a scholarship offer Friday from Clemson.
The 6-foot-7 Johnson also considered UNLV, Charlotte, LSU and Xavier after USC granted him a release from his letter-of-intent. The Trojans are being investigated by the NCAA.

Johnson told the AJC that, besides academics, he was drawn to Clemson by its “winning tradition.” At the same time, he said, “They seem to die at the end of the season. I’m trying to be that missing piece.”
He also was recruited at one time by Georgia Tech and more recently by Georgia’s coach Mark Fox, who was hired in April.
Johnson is ranked No. 53 nationally by Rivals.com among just-graduated high school seniors and 56th by Scout.com.
